Rudyard Kipling's "The Jungle Book" has captivated readers for over a century with its enchanting tales of Mowgli, a young boy raised by wolves in the Indian jungle. The book is a fascinating blend of adventure, morality, and imagination, making it a timeless classic that continues to resonate with readers of all ages.

What sets "The Jungle Book" apart is not just its captivating storyline, but also the insightful themes it explores. Kipling delves into the concepts of friendship, family, and the struggle between civilization and the wild. Through Mowgli's encounters with various animal characters, readers are encouraged to reflect on their own values and the moral dilemmas of our complex world.

Although "The Jungle Book" may be most commonly associated with children, its depth and richness make it equally appealing to adult readers. Its universal themes of identity, morality, and belonging strike a chord with readers of all generations.
